The Central Iowa AC needs your help to fill the following council positions:
Secretary
·Take minutes at board meetings and member events and keep a record of attendance.
·Handle correspondence as requested by the president.
·Assist president with reports.
·Send get-well, condolence, and congratulatory messages to members.
Collegiate Relations Chair
·Maintain close and frequent contact with local collegiate chapters through their alumnae relations chairs and CABs to determine ways in which the AC can best support the chapter.
·Coordinate alumnae support for chapter-sponsored joint events.
·Plan joint events with the chapters.
·Make arrangements for Senior Induction.
Membership Chair
·Plan the membership recruitment campaign and develop ways to promote the AC among local alumnae.
·Contact potential and inactive members.
·Set a telephone committee to contact members for KD events. Organize a car pool.
·Assign greeters to make new members feel welcome at meetings.
·Follow up after events with calls or notes to first time attendees.
·Compile a directory of members to be given to every member of the AC. (See the appendix for more information on compiling a directory/yearbook.)
Social Chair
·Survey members to determine the type of programs/events they would like.
·Plan a variety of programs/events for the year that appeal to members of all ages.
·Assist with membership meetings that include food service.
·Make reservations at restaurants and other venues.
·Provide nametags for attendees.
·Send news releases to local media. In large cities publicity is difficult to place in major newspapers, but localized coverage is possible in smaller publications. Try having major events publicized on local radio and television outlets.
·Use the Kappa Delta Web site and KD Connect to advertise AC events.
·Send information to The Angelos as requested by the editor.
·Report as requested to National Kappa Delta
Philanthropy Chair
·Work with the program/event chair to plan a Shamrock Event or create events that incorporate working with Girl Scouts.
·Serve as the liaison between these organizations and the AC.
·Work with the public relations chair to develop a plan to publicize philanthropy events.
·Submit the Shamrock Participation Report Form to HQ by December 1. Submit the Final Report Form and check to HQ by April 1.
·Encourage individual members and the AC to make donations to the Kappa Delta Foundation by publicizing work of the foundation.
